Despite them not being an actual season (technically they’re part of Series 4), the 2008-2010 Specials of the new ‘Doctor Who’ TV series could be argued as being David Tennant’s fifth season of ‘Doctor Who’. This is despite him not having a regular companion accompanying him in the specials.

‘Planet of the Dead’ could be argued as being a decent season opener, especially with the introduction of Michelle Ryan as Lady Christina de Souza. I would have liked a season featuring the Tenth Doctor and Christina on adventures together. A pity Big Finish have not followed that through.

‘The End of Time’ can also be considered as the finale of a ‘Doctor Who’ season; especially with it being a two-parter, David Tennant’s Doctor battling against John Simm’s Master, and of course being the closing story of not just the David Tennant/Tenth Doctor era, but also the Russell T. Davies era. 🙂

The 2008-2010 Specials showcase the best of David Tennant’s time as the Tenth Doctor in ‘Doctor Who’. As well as ‘Planet of the Dead’ and ‘The End of Time’, ‘The Next Doctor’ illustrates how David Tennant’s Doctor can cope well in tackling Cybermen, especially at Christmas time in Victorian London. 🙂

‘The Waters of Mars’ also illustrates the range of emotions David Tennant’s Doctor can project, especially in being concerned about the fate of the Bowie Base One crew on Mars and how it led to his dark path in becoming the Time Lord Victorious. It features one of David’s best performances.
